
Daniel Haro Méndez
Daniel Haro Méndez is a Venezuelan politician affiliated with the Chavista government, who assumed the mayoral position of Pedro María Freites after winning elections in 2013. His administration has been criticized for corruption and mismanagement, particularly regarding the distribution of resources and support to the local community.
